Many libraries also provide free e - book lending services. You can check with your local library and see if they have an e - library system where you can borrow novels for free. Some libraries use apps like Libby or OverDrive for this purpose. Another option is to look for free novel promotions on Amazon Kindle. From time to time, they offer certain novels for free as a marketing strategy.
